  • UHD Graphics 630 has 25% more power consumption, than Radeon R5 Bristol Ridge.
  • Radeon R5 Bristol Ridge is used in Laptops, and UHD Graphics 630 - in Desktops.
  • Radeon R5 Bristol Ridge is build with GCN 1.2/2.0 architecture, and UHD Graphics 630 - with Gen. 9.5.
  • Radeon R5 Bristol Ridge is manufactured by 28 nm process technology, and UHD Graphics 630 - by 14 nm process technology.
